Conclusions:
The estimated vapour pressure is 2.79 hPa at 25°C using the Modified Grain Method.
Executive summary:

For calculation of the vapour pressure EPISuit was used (EPIWIN v. 4.1). The estimated vapour pressure is 2.79 hPa at 25°C using the Modified Grain Method.
